Growing Conditions for Italian Salad Seeds

  • Light Requirements: Prefers full sun to partial shade, ideally receiving 6-8 hours of sunlight daily
  • Soil Type: Thrives in well-draining, fertile soil rich in organic matter with a pH of 6.0 to 7.0
  • Temperature: Best grown in cool temperatures, ideally between 60°F to 75°F

Planting Tips for Italian Salad Seeds

  • Seed Depth: Sow seeds ¼ inch deep in the soil
  • Spacing: Space plants 6 to 12 inches apart to allow for proper growth and airflow
  • Timing: Start seeds indoors 4-6 weeks before the last frost or sow directly outdoors in early spring or late summer

Watering Instructions and Tips

  • Watering Frequency: Water regularly to keep the soil consistently moist, especially during dry spells
  • Moisture Level: Ensure good drainage to prevent root rot; avoid letting the soil dry out completely
  • Mulching: Apply a layer of mulch to help retain moisture and suppress weeds
